Peter Brian Gabriel (born February 13, 1950, in Cobham, Surrey, England) is an English musician. He number 1 come to fame as a member of the progressive rock group Genesis, went in to the successful solo career, & supplementary recently has focused on producing & promoting world music and pioneering digital distribution methods for music. Additionally he has been taking part around various humanistic efforts.

Early history
Gabriel founded Genesis spell as a student at Charterhouse School with bandmates Tony Banks, Anthony Phillips, and Mike Rutherford.

Genesis quickly became one of a virtually all talked-all about elastic in the UK & in time Italy, Belgium & more European countries, largely imputable Gabriel's flamboyant stage presence, which included many gonzo costume changes & comic, surreal stories told when a introduction to both song. A few of his best known costumes come "The Flower" (worn for "Supper's Ready", from either Fox-trot), "Britannia" (worn for "Dancing With The Moonlit Knight", from either Selling England per Pound), "Old King Cole" (worn for "The Musical Box", from either Nursery Cryme) & "Rael" (worn throughout virtually all of the performance of the album A Lamb Lies Down in Broadway).

When you took "The Knife", a popular survive song from either the Trespass album, Gabriel would perform the stunt that, 2 decades late, became the fixture of difficult-rock & strong-metal concerts: stage diving. In 1 occasion, he broke a leg leaping into a crowd - however managed to climb back higher onto a stage & finish the performance. Gabriel now and then would fall backwards into crowds when you took his solo shows (notably shown around his concert film PoV in a period of the song "Lay Your Hands On Me") & allow a crowd to pass him about, however stopped crowd surfriding when he became older.

Backing vocals inside Genesis when you took Gabriel's tenure in the band were commonly handled by drummer Phil Collins, who within time became a lead singer fallowing Gabriel left a band in 1975.

The "untitled era"

Gabriel recorded his 1st solo album inside 1976 and 1977 with producer Bob Ezrin, simply titled Peter Gabriel. His 1st solo profits come using a lone "Solsbury Hill", an autobiographical piece expressing his thoughts on allowing Genesis. Inside it, he sings, "My friends would think I was a nut...", alluding to his guide to lead off a period of self-exploration & reflection, when he grew cabbages, played the piano for yearn hours, practiced yoga and biofeedback, and spent quality instance by having his personal.

Gabriel worked by using guitar player Robert Fripp (of King Crimson fame) as producer of his 2nd solo LP, within 1978. That album was darker & other experimental, & yielded a few mulct recordings, however there is no major hits. His third, within 1980, arose as a collaboration using Steve Lillywhite, who as well produced early albums by U2. It was notable for the hit singles "Games Without Frontiers" & "Biko," for Gabriel's newly interest inside globe music (especially for percussion), & for its bold production, which processed extensive have of recording tricks & healthy results.

Additionally, Gabriel's old Genesis band-mate Phil Collins played drums in many tracks, including a opener, "Intruder," which introduced to a globe the reverse-gated, cymbal-less drum kit healthy which Collins would produce celebrated through the rest of the Eighties. A massive, distinctive hollow healthy arose across a select few experiments by Collins & engineer Hugh Padgham. Gabriel got requested that his drummers apply there are no cymbals in the album's sessions, & after he heard the symptom from either Collins & Padgham, he asked Collins to play a elementary pattern for many minutes, so built "Intruder" thereon.

Hard & at times dampish recording sessions at his rural English estate within 1981 and 1982, with co-producer/engineer David Lord, resulted within Gabriel's 4th LP release (a aforesaid Security), in which Gabriel took extra production responsibility. It was one of a 1st commercial albums recorded totally to digital tape (applying a Sony free to roam truck), & featured the early, pleasantly expensive Fairlight CMI sampling computer. Gabriel combined the kind of sampled & deconstructed sounds by using globe-beat percussion & more unusual instrumentation to produce the radically fresh, emotionally charged soundscape. Moreover, a sleeve art consisted of deep, streaming video-depending mental imagery. Despite a album's peculiar healthy, odd appearance, & typically troubling themes, it sold swell & experienced the hit lone around "Shock the Monkey", which too became the innovational music video.

Gabriel toured extensively for every of his albums, continuing a spectacular shows he began by owning Genesis, typically involving elaborate stage props & acrobatics which experienced him suspended from either gauntry, distorting his face by owning fresnel lenses and mirrors, and wearing unusual makeup. For 1 tour, his entire band shaved their heads. His 1982-83 tour involved the division opening for David Bowie, where several audience members & critics thought that Gabriel when opener (especially by having his elaborate makeup) overshadowed Bowie at a height of his popularity. A stage was placed for Gabriel's admittedly break using his next studio release.

The hit years: So, Passion, Us, and Up

Although early he achieved critical profits & a select few commercial profits (e.g. "Games Without Frontiers" from either his third album & "Shock the Monkey" from either either his quaternary), Gabriel achieved his greatest popularity by using songs from a 1986 So album, most notably "Sledgehammer" & "In Your Eyes." Gabriel co-produced And then by owning American Daniel Lanois, also known for his operate by owning U2. Gabriel's song "Sledgehammer" was accompanied by a visually stunning music video, which was a collaboration by using director Stephen Johnson, Aardman Animation, and a Brothers Quay. A streaming videos won many awards at a 1987 MTV Music Video Awards, and placed the newly standard for art in the music streaming video industry. The watch-higher streaming for the song "Big Time" too broke recently ground around music videos animation & favorite results.

Within 1989, Gabriel freed Passion, the soundtrack for Martin Scorsese's movie The Last Temptation of Christ. Numbers of assume a album to exist as a climax of his operate within world music. As a consequence it, Gabriel recorded Us in 1992 (also co-produced sustaining Lanois), an album where he deals by having a painful sensation of his life problems of a former years (his failing foremost marriage, the few feet away by owning his foremost girl). He metaphorically talks to the flow of any stream: "River, river, carry me on to the place where I come from... Bring me something that will let me get to sleep... Bring me something to take this pain away." He too digs within, trying to unearth a items in of him that induce him condition in the song "Digging in the Dirt". He fights for across to his girl around "Come Talk To Me".

the effect was of these of his virtually all personalized albums, followed by the globe tour that consisted of deuce stages: the circular one and the square one, united by a bridge that he crossed riding a boat.

Around 2000, he followed United states by owning a music to OVO, a soundtrack for the Millennium Dome Show in London, and Long Walk Home, a music from either the Australian motion picture Rabbit-Proof Fence, early in 2002. Within September 2002, he freed Up, his most recent good-length album, which was completely self-self-generated, & returned to a bit of of the less commercial, darker themes of this operate in the late '70s & early '80s. Aside from either a ending soft ballad "The Drop," there is no song in Higher is shorter than captawithin hicks proceedings, & numbers of last across many distinct movements, by having awesome kinetics in healthy & theme.

Musicians and collaborators

When a gaps between his studio album releases develop be hanker & hanker (sextet years between And then & The states, 10 between The states & Higher), Gabriel has continued to act by using the comparatively stable crew of musicians & recording engineers. Bass and Stick player Tony Levin, for example, has appeared in each Peter Gabriel studio album & tour since 1976 & guitar player David Rhodes has been Gabriel’s guitarist of guide since 1979, two in the studio & on tour. Gabriel is known for finding top-top-hole collaborators, from either co-producers like Ezrin, Fripp, Lillywhite, & Lanois to musicians like Yossou N'Dour, Larry Fast, Nusrat Fateh Ali Khan, Paula Cole, Manu Katché, and Stewart Copeland.

On top a years, Gabriel has collaborated by using singer Kate Bush several times; Bush provided backing vocals for Gabriel's when far back when "Games Without Frontiers" inside 1980, & in "No Self Control" & "Don't Give Up" (the Top 30 hit) within 1986, & Gabriel appeared in her television favorite. Their duet of Roy Harper's "Another Day" was discussed for release as a lone, however never appeared.

He besides collaborated by owning Laurie Anderson on two versions of her composition "Excellent Birds" - of these for her album, Mister Heartbreak, & the slightly different version known as This is the Picture which appeared in cassette and CD versions of Then. Around 1987, after presenting Gabriel by owning an award for his music video cds, Anderson related an occasion where a recording session got no more late into the nighttime & Gabriel's voice began to healthy somewhat unknown, about surreal. It was found that he experienced fallen asleep before of the mike, however experienced continued to sing.

Remarkably, around 1998 Gabriel appeared on the soundtrack of Babe: Pig in the City, not when a composer, however as a singer of the song "That'll Do", written by Randy Newman. A song was nominated for an Academy Award, & Gabriel and Newman performed it at a below season's Oscar telecast. Several world health organization saw him thereon broadcast didn't recognize him, since his hair got greyed & thinned since his virtually all recent tour many years earliest.

WOMAD and other projects
Gabriel has been interested around world music for many years, by having a 1st musical grounds to believe appearing in his third album. This influence has increased on top period, & he is a drive behind the WOMAD (World of Music, Arts & Dance) movement. He created the Real World Studios & record label to facilitate a creation & distribution of such music by various creative person, and he hwhen worked to educate Western civilization just about a act of such musicians as Nusrat Fateh Ali Khan and Youssou N'dour. He has too recently been interested around multimedia projects, creating the Xplora & Eve Video-ROMs. He has an extended-standing interest within human rights, and launched a Witness programme to supply streaming cameras to person rights militant to expose abuses.

Gabriel's song "We Do What We're Told (Milgram's 37)" from either And then refers to Milgram's experiment, and in particular the 37 out of 40 subjects who showed complete obedience in one particular experiment.

He was one of a founders of In Require Distribution (OD2), one of a foremost on the net music download services. Its technology is utilized by MSN Music UK & others, and has get a dominant music download technology platform for places inside Europe. OD2 was bought by U.s.a. company Loudeye around June of 2004.

In addition, Gabriel is likewise co-founder (by using Brian Eno) of a musicians union known as Mudda, short for "magnificent union of digitally downloading artists."

Around June, 2005, Gabriel & broadcast industry enterpriser David Engelke purchased Firm State Logic, the leading manufacturer of mixing consoles & digital audio workstations.
